These two are exceptional studio potters and should have won the Premier Portage Award years ago as far as I'm concerned.

Here is their majestic entry in the Portage Ceramic Awards this year

Sang Sool Shim and Keum Sun Lee Dscf2218

and this inspired me to get a piece of their work from the Te Uru Gallery shop today when visiting.  Just a darling little hanging heart with exquisite detail on it including koru.  I love you

Sang Sool Shim and Keum Sun Lee Dscf2336

Bonus that it has their mark on the back !!  
My shortened name for them is Shim and Lee Smile
